Как создать окно чата во flutter без firebase?

#flutter #dart #flutter-layout #chatbot

#flutter #dart #flutter-макет #чат-бот

Вопрос:

Мне нужно задать сомнение через окно чата преподавателю в моем приложении. Отправленное сообщение должно быть сохранено в базе данных. Как я могу этого добиться. Пожалуйста, помогите мне.

Комментарии:

1. Этот вопрос слишком широк для Stack Overflow. Вы не можете достичь этого с помощью Flutter во внешнем интерфейсе. Вам нужен сервер. Итак, что можно сделать с помощью серверной части? Можете ли вы создать API? Можете ли вы создать и использовать базу данных? Где именно вы застряли и вам нужна помощь?

2. Да, у меня есть серверная часть на моем сервере, которая вызывается через API. Я создал таблицу для «Задать сомнение» в базе данных. Когда я отправляю сообщение, оно должно храниться в базе данных, и оно должно повторно получать ответ с сервера и отображать его на экране чата.

3. Хорошо. Опять же, в каком именно месте вы застряли? Вы можете писать в свою таблицу? Вы можете читать из таблицы? Какой у вас стек, что вы используете для общения в реальном времени?

4. Я создал экран чата, но я не знаю, как отправить сообщение и сохранить, а также как восстановить сообщение и отобразить.

5. Хорошо. Я использую здесь php в качестве серверной части и MySQL в качестве серверной части. Я застрял в том, как написать код для отправки и повторного создания сообщения, передав идентификатор через API в flutter

Ответ №1:

Вы можете использовать сокет.ввод-вывод для базы данных в реальном времени.